The American justice system is built on the principle of equal access to justice, regardless of socio-economic status. Public defenders play a vital role in upholding this principle by providing representation to those who cannot afford private attorneys. In the US, public defenders are employed by local governments to represent individuals who are too poor to hire a private attorney. This ensures that everyone, regardless of income, has access to competent legal representation.

How it works

Public defenders are attorneys employed by the government to represent individuals who cannot afford private attorneys. Here's a simplified overview of the process:

  • Intake: Public defenders review cases and determine if they have the resources to take on the case.

  • Investigation: Public defenders conduct thorough investigations, gathering evidence and interviewing witnesses to build a strong defense.

  • Representation: Public defenders represent their clients in court, advocating for their rights and interests.

H3: What is the difference between a public defender and a private attorney?

Public defenders are employed by the government to represent individuals who cannot afford private attorneys. Private attorneys, on the other hand, are independent professionals who charge clients for their services.

H3: Are public defenders good enough to trust with my case?

Public defenders are trained to provide quality representation, just like private attorneys. However, the quality of representation can sometimes vary depending on the availability of resources and the caseload of the public defender's office.

H3: Who is eligible for a public defender?

In the United States, public defenders are typically employed to represent individuals who are too poor to hire a private attorney. This includes those who are facing charges in state or federal court and have limited financial resources.

H3: Can I get a public defender outside of court?

While public defenders are often associated with court appearances, they also provide representation in various settings, including initial hearings, interrogations, and negotiations with prosecutors.

Opportunities and realistic risks

Public defenders offer invaluable representation for individuals who cannot afford private attorneys. However, there are also potential risks to consider:

  • Casework burden: Public defenders often face heavy caseloads, which can impact the quality of representation.

  • Limited resources: Public defenders may have limited budgets for investigations and expert witnesses, which can affect the defense strategy.

  • Prosecutorial pressure: The public defender's office may face strong opposition from prosecutors, particularly in cases where the evidence is weak.
